start_documentcode    nextTop
 Title   : start_document
 Usage   : $obj->start_document
 Function: PerlSAX method called when a new document is initialized
 Returns : nothing
 Args    : document name
end_documentcodeprevnextTop
 Title   : end_document
 Usage   : $obj->end_document
 Function: PerlSAX method called when a document is finished for cleaning up
 Returns : list of features seen
 Args    : document name
start_elementcodeprevnextTop
 Title   : start_element
 Usage   : $obj->start_element
 Function: PerlSAX method called when a new element is reached
 Returns : nothing
 Args    : element object
end_elementcodeprevnextTop
 Title   : end_element
 Usage   : $obj->end_element
 Function: PerlSAX method called when an element is finished
 Returns : nothing
 Args    : element object
characterscodeprevnextTop
 Title   : characters
 Usage   : $obj->end_element
 Function: PerlSAX method called when text between XML tags is reached
 Returns : nothing
 Args    : text
in_elementcodeprevnextTop
 Title   : in_element
 Usage   : $obj->in_element
 Function: PerlSAX method called to test if state is in a specific element
 Returns : boolean
 Args    : name of element
within_elementcodeprevnextTop
 Title   : within_element
 Usage   : $obj->within_element
 Function: PerlSAX method called to list depth within specific element
 Returns : boolean
 Args    : name of element
AUTOLOADcodeprevnextTop
 Title   : AUTOLOAD
 Usage   : do not use directly
 Function: autoload handling of missing DESTROY method
 Returns : nothing
 Args    : text

end_elementdescriptionprevnextTop
sub end_element {
    my ($self, $element) = @_;

    if ($self->in_element('bx-computation:program')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'source_tag'} = $self->{'string'};
    }

    if ($self->in_element('bx-annotation:author')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'source_tag'} = "Annotated by $self->{'string'}.";
    }

    if ($self->in_element('bx-feature:type')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'primary_tag'} = $self->{'string'};
    }

    if ($self->in_element('bx-feature:start')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'start'} = $self->{'string'};
    }

    if ($self->in_element('bx-feature:end')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'end'} = $self->{'string'};
    }

    if ($self->in_element('bx-computation:score')) {
	$self->{'string'} =~ s/^\s+//g;
	$self->{'string'} =~ s/\s+$//;
	$self->{'string'} =~ s/\n//g;
	$self->{'feat'}->{'score'} = $self->{'string'};
    }

    if ($self->in_element('bx-feature:seq_relationship')) {
	
	if ($self->{'feat'}->{'start'} > $self->{'feat'}->{'end'}) {
	    my $new_start = $self->{'feat'}->{'end'};
	    $self->{'feat'}->{'end'} = $self->{'feat'}->{'start'};
	    $self->{'feat'}->{'start'} = $new_start;
	    $self->{'feat'}->{'strand'} = -1;
	} else {
	    $self->{'feat'}->{'strand'} = 1;
	}
	my $new_feat = new Bio::SeqFeature::Generic
	    (
	     -start   => $self->{'feat'}->{'start'},
	     -end     => $self->{'feat'}->{'end'},
	     -strand  => $self->{'feat'}->{'strand'},
	     -source  => $self->{'feat'}->{'source_tag'},
	     -primary => $self->{'feat'}->{'primary_tag'},
	     -score   => $self->{'feat'}->{'score'},
	     );
	
	if (defined $self->{'feat'}->{'computation_id'}) {
	    $new_feat->add_tag_value('computation_id', 
				     $self->{'feat'}->{'computation_id'} );
	} elsif (defined $self->{'feat'}->{'annotation_id'}) {
	    $new_feat->add_tag_value('annotation_id', 
				     $self->{'feat'}->{'annotation_id'} );
	}
	if (defined $self->{'feat'}->{'id'}) {
	    $new_feat->add_tag_value('id', $self->{'feat'}->{'id'} );
	}

	push @{$self->{'feats'}}, $new_feat;
	$self->{'feat'} = { 
	    seqid => $self->{'feat'}->{'curr_seqid'},
	    primary_tag => $self->{'feat'}->{'primary_tag'},
	    source_tag => $self->{'feat'}->{'source_tag'},
	    computation_id => $self->{'feat'}->{'computation_id'},
	    annotation_id => $self->{'feat'}->{'annotation_id'}
	}
    }


    pop @{$self->{'Names'}};
    pop @{$self->{'Nodes'}};
}
